I put together a list of pricing, last year, of items at Aldi Supermarket. I am posting the information here and providing you a list of all the prices on the items that Aldi carries. I do want to say, I am in no way affiliated with or receive any benefits from promoting Aldi Supermarket. I am just a mom who happens to love shopping there and saving our family money. The prices listed are what they were this past winter- the pricing may have changed, however, Aldi usually does not do a dramatic change in their pricing so this should be an accurate portrayal of their current prices. The items that have a star next to them are items that are carried seasonally or the item prices change according to the season/farmers. They may or may not be available at the time you come to visit the store.
